Output 1dfe6a94f810cff14ac84158c361b3fd5f7756b1f60eaa886bb80c288d7e3394:1

value
260100
script pubkey
OP_0 OP_PUSHBYTES_20 86956863cfcb0af9c8505cfa340d5b7fba918bba
address
bc1qs62ksc70ev90njzstnargr2m07afrza642846y
transaction
1dfe6a94f810cff14ac84158c361b3fd5f7756b1f60eaa886bb80c288d7e3394
confirmations
102176
spent
true